KIPP DuBois Collegiate Academy's recent rough patch got a bit rougher on Wednesday after their fifth straight loss. They took a hard 48-31 fall against Parkway West. KIPP DuBois Collegiate Academy has struggled against the HOYAS recently, as their contest on Wednesday was their third consecutive lost matchup.
Parkway West's win was the result of several impressive offensive performances. One of the most notable came from Nymira Bryant, who scored 17 points. That makes it six consecutive games in which Bryant has scored at least a third of Parkway West's points. The team also got some help courtesy of Kemba Brown, who scored 15 points.
KIPP DuBois Collegiate Academy's loss was their fourth straight at home dating back to last season, which dropped their record down to 1-5. As for Parkway West, the victory (which was their eighth in a row) raised their record to 8-4.
